Saskatchewan celebrates ten statutory holidays, many of which are celebrated throughout Canada. Like other provinces in the country, Saskatchewan’s government can determine additional holidays that may be considered statutory as well.
Saskatchewan Day is celebrated on the first Monday in August and is designed to celebrate the heritage of the province. Victoria Day and Canada Day are also both statutory holidays in Saskatchewan. The province also celebrates Family Day in February in honor of the province’s families and their support of their local community.
